ORIGINAL AIR DATE: Thursday, June 18, 2015 | 10:00 AM (PDT) | 1:00PM (EDT)
Join John Chapin on Thursday, June 18, 2015 as he discusses Domain Separation in this session to examine the basics that include:
- Global Scope
- The Top domain
- Process Domains
- Data Accessibility
- Process Inheritance
John Chapin has been in IT for over 20 years. Prior to joining ServiceNow he migrated from Remedy to ServiceNow while working for a financial firm in New York city.
Over 4 years ago he came to ServiceNow as an Engagement Manager in Professional Services. John is currently a Senior Solution Consultant at ServiceNow, working with our MSP partners.
